Transaction 4afc58310d1d05ee2949abc82b30b13746914c5f2a529b833a1ba29c579736db

1 Input
2 Outputs
  • 4afc58310d1d05ee2949abc82b30b13746914c5f2a529b833a1ba29c579736db:0
  • value  8915309
    address  1EDKZDELJRXB2c2FtBpW9at8RUcc1KHVSK
  • 4afc58310d1d05ee2949abc82b30b13746914c5f2a529b833a1ba29c579736db:1
  • value  1680035
    address  3BD4xwEY4rasaJoQ3PUPTnfoiijPsFbSWP